Calling: Tuesday, August 6, 2013 - Noon to 2 p.m. in the funeral home *************************************************************************** Reva Clifton, 85, of Rome City died Friday, August 2, 2013, at 11:19 p.m. in her residence with her family at her side. She shared her home with her grandson and wife, Thom and Samantha Clifton and their family for the last six years.

Reva was a member of New Beginnings Community Church in Fort Wayne.

She had worked at Essex Wire in Ligonier from 1962 to 1973. She also prepared taxes for the people of the community for numerous years.

"Our Mother touched the lives of many people. She loved God and her family foremost. She enjoyed crocheting, reading, gardening, nature, and painting. We believe Mother's family extended beyond her children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and sister as she embraced everyone she met and they became family to her. And, she will be greatly missed."

She was born February 21, 1928, in Hardburley, Kentucky, to William and Loretta (Ritchie) Barnett. On February 12, 1947, in Kentucky she married John Clifton, Jr. He preceded her in death on September 3, 2005.

Surviving are two sons, Tim (Cheryl) Clifton of Rome City and Tony (Wendy) Clifton of Bettendorf, Iowa; two daughters, Jean (Gary) Glenn of Melbourne, Florida, and Sherry (Steve) Siewert of LaGrange; 13 grandchildren; 17 great-grandchildren; and a sister, Marie Fugate of Fisty, Kentucky.

She was also preceded in death by a son, John Clifton, III; a grandson, John Joseph Clifton; a sister, Geneva Smith; two brothers, Leslie Barnett and Richard Barnett; and two half sisters, Hazel Martin and Ruby Barnett.

Funeral services will be Tuesday, August 6, 2013, at 2 p.m. in Young Family Funeral Home, Wolcottville Chapel, State Road 9 North, Wolcottville with Pastor Robert Abels of New Beginnings Community Church officiating. Burial of Reva, along with the cremains of her husband John, will be together in Orange Cemetery, Rome City.
